Frequently asked questions

Does the 2019 Hyundai Santa FE have electrical system problems?

Electrical System is the #4 most-reported problem area on the 2019 Hyundai Santa FE: 24 of 191 complaints on file (12.6%). Complaints are unverified owner reports, not confirmed defects.

How many complaints does the 2019 Hyundai Santa FE have in total?

191 complaints were on file with NHTSA as of 07/12/2026. Across all categories, 16 involved a crash, 11 involved a fire, 10 reported injuries, and none reported deaths.
